Now meet my friend bossy "r."
Whenever you come before
The letter "r,"
You will change your sound.
"A,"you make the "ah"sound,
Like in "cat,"
But "r"will change you to "ar,"
Like in "car."
"E,"you make the "eh"sound,
Like in "hen,"
But "r"will change you to "er,"
Like in "her."
"I,"you make the "ih"sound,
Like in "sit,"
But "r"will change you to "er,"
Like in "sir."
"O,"you make the "ah"sound,
Like in "spot,"
But "r"will change you to "or,"
Like in "sport,"
And you, "u"--yes, you, "u"--
You make the "uh"sound,
Like in "fun,"
But "r"will change you to "er,"
Like in "fur."
Everybody got that? Ok.
